So I found a model which I linked to in the page on the Proteus 281, and I modified it
Ignore the giant engines, as this was more an aerodynamics and COG + COT + COL test than a realistic module
Here is a photo of the (glitch yet viable) aircraft taking off in it's current form
Stock KSP does not support EDFs or Servos so the lift engines are fixed, and in-wing
Also the Stock KSP Controls do not allow for easy on the spot thrust control of multiple engine groups (at least to my ability) so it frequently crashes
I did get it to take off vertically a few times, STOL is super easy, and it could still do standard take offs and landings
One thing to consider is this did not model the drag from the lift engines, only their thrust, as I esentiially clipped them through the model
All in all it looks promising
